Removing engine from top... Do I need to remove headers?
Pulling my motor from the top tomorrow. I have Pacesetter longtube headers and was wondering if it is possible to just unbolt the headers and move them to the side a few inches, or do I need to fully remove the headers to pull the motor from the top?
